Wheezing: Check his rom which might be a cause for his wheezing such as a down pillow, stuffed animals, cat or shedding dog. Also look for dust catchers such as venetian blinds or books. Make sure the window is closed and the air conditioning going, hopefully with a clean filter

Asthma control: Use nebulizer with Albuterol as directed by his doctor, ~ 3-4 x/day. Use only one oral bronchodilator, Albuterol, as directed, ~ 3 x/day. Don't give a cough suppressant See doctor now & in follow-up for maintenance medications. Seek evaluations for gastroesophageal reflux & allergies.
